After a harrowing battle to sever the shadow’s influence, Eleanor thought the nightmare was over. But the shadow’s whispers linger, its fragments scattered and stirring in the forgotten corners of Brookhaven. Strange occurrences ripple through the town. A creeping fog, cryptic warnings, and a chilling presence known as the watcher. Eleanor realizes the shadow’s power was only a warning of something far greater. Something ancient and bound to the town’s tragic past.
Guided by a cryptic ledger and an enigmatic relic that seems to know more than it reveals, Eleanor discovers the Wellspring, a source of immense power hidden beneath Brookhaven. The Wellspring isn’t just a force of creation. It’s the root of the shadow’s existence. Protected by skeletal guardians and cloaked in riddles, it offers no easy answers. To secure the town’s future, Eleanor must face a choice that will define not only the Wellspring’s fate but her own: light or shadow, creation or destruction. Each path holds its own peril, and neither guarantees salvation.
She has her loyal allies. Grace, a compassionate nurse who has seen too much, and Tara, whose sharp wit hides her growing fear. With them, Eleanor delves into the depths of the Wellspring’s mystery. Together, they confront cursed chapels, twisting voids, and the very fabric of their town’s history, uncovering the truth about Brookhaven’s founding and the price of its survival.
But the Wellspring demands more than courage. It demands a sacrifice. And as the entities of light and shadow reveal their ultimatum, Eleanor must decide how much she is willing to lose to save the people she loves.
As Brookhaven’s fate hangs in the balance, will Eleanor’s choice end the curse, or awaken something far darker?
